Technology Process of Piperidine, 1-(phenylselenoxomethyl)-

There total 5 articles about Piperidine, 1-(phenylselenoxomethyl)- which guide to synthetic route it. synthetic route:
Guidance literature:
N-benzoylpiperidine; With oxalyl dichloride; In dichloromethane; at -78 - 25 ℃; for 1h;
With [tetrabutylammonium]2[WSe4]; In dichloromethane; at -78 - 25 ℃; for 0.5h; Further stages.;
DOI:10.1016/j.tetlet.2003.11.067
Guidance literature:
benzonitrile; With selenium; carbon monoxide; water; In tetrahydrofuran; at 110 ℃; under 11251.1 Torr; Autoclave;
piperidine; In tetrahydrofuran; water; at 110 ℃; for 4h; Autoclave;
DOI:10.1021/ol9001976
Guidance literature:
With selenium; sodium hydride; In N,N,N,N,N,N-hexamethylphosphoric triamide; at 130 ℃; for 6h;
DOI:10.1246/cl.1994.2105
